코딩테스트/백준

[백준][Python]10814. 나이순 정렬

내만 2022. 8. 22. 17:46
728x90
반응형

반응형

 

 

 

 

 

 

🙆‍♂️문제


 

🙋‍♂️풀이


 

 

🚀 입력받기


n = int(input())
arr = [list(input().split()) for _ in range(n)]
for i in range(n):
    arr[i][0] = int(arr[i][0])

입력을 받고 for문을 사용해서 나이 값(arr[i][0])을 int형으로 형변환 해줍니다.

 

🚀 문제 풀이 핵심


arr.sort(key=lambda x:x[0])

key값을 나이값으로 맞춰주기 위해 x:x[0]을 해줍니다.

 

🚀 출력하기


for i in range(n):
    print(arr[i][0],arr[i][1])

출력합니다.

728x90

728x90
반응형